Subaru AWD Benefits in Severe Weather
When it comes to unpredictable weather, having a reliable vehicle is essential. The Subaru AWD severe weather system is designed to provide stability and control, even in challenging conditions. With its symmetrical all-wheel drive, Subaru vehicles maintain traction on wet and slippery roads, reducing the risk of skidding and hydroplaning. This feature is particularly beneficial during heavy rain and flooding, common occurrences in Lakeland during hurricane season.
Advantages of Subaru AWD:
- Enhanced Traction: Symmetrical AWD distributes power evenly to all wheels, providing better grip on wet surfaces.
- Improved Stability: The low center of gravity and balanced weight distribution enhance handling in adverse conditions.
- Reliable Control: Subaru AWD systems are engineered to quickly respond to changes in road conditions, ensuring a safer drive.
By understanding these advantages, Subaru owners can confidently navigate through severe weather, knowing their vehicle is built to withstand the elements.
Vehicle Preparation Essentials
Preparing your vehicle for hurricane season involves more than just regular maintenance. Focusing on specific areas will ensure your Subaru is in top condition to face the challenges of summer storms.
Key Areas to Inspect:
- Tire Tread Depth: Ensure your tires have adequate tread to maintain traction on wet roads. Consider all-season or winter tires for enhanced grip.
- Battery Condition: Check the battery for corrosion and ensure it holds a charge. A reliable battery is vital during power outages.
- Fluid Levels: Regularly check and top up essential fluids like oil, coolant, and windshield washer fluid.
- Emergency Kit Essentials: Include items such as a first aid kit, flashlight, jumper cables, and non-perishable snacks. Having an emergency car kit Florida is vital for unexpected situations.
Evacuation Readiness
In the event of an evacuation, your Subaru should be ready to support a smooth and safe journey. Proper preparation will alleviate stress and ensure you have everything necessary for a successful evacuation.
Evacuation Preparation Tips:
- Fuel Tank Management: Keep your fuel tank at least half full to avoid running out of gas during an evacuation.
- Recovery Kit: Pack tools such as a shovel, tow rope, and traction mats to assist if you get stuck.
- Navigation Prep: Ensure your GPS is updated with current maps, and consider alternative routes in case of road closures.
By following these tips, you can be assured that your Subaru is prepared for any evacuation scenario.
